Kelly McGonigal (@kellymcgonigal) is a research psychologist, a lecturer at Stanford University, and an award-winning science writer. She is the author of The Joy of Movement, The Willpower Instinct, and The Upside of Stress.

What We Discuss with Kelly McGonigal:

How much does the way you think about stress affect your health? • Contrary to what medical professionals have been telling you for years, can there really be such a thing as good stress? •

• Why trying to shame someone • out of a harmful coping mechanism (overeating, smoking, etc.) can generate the very stress that prompts reliance on that mechanism. •

• How anxiety, pangs of loneliness, and other indications of stress can be seen as calls to action • instead of triggers for inappropriate responses.

How do genetics play into your relationship with stress? • And much more...
